Off the Wall was an exhibition by four Mayo artists who completed a summer residency together at ATU Mayo Campus, which was formerly a Mental Health Institution.
My work for the exhibition included a sculptural installation Mindfullnest, and paintings all of which referenced the progression in treatment approaches to mental health in Ireland over the past century. It contrasted the long-term residential confinement within the former Asylum to the medical model of the St Mary’s Psychiatric Hospital. Finally the community approach of the Mayo Recovery College, which is hosted in the building, was explored. It encapsulates a more positive and holistic vision, based on the understanding that people can become mentally well again if given the right mix of supports, including techniques such as Mindfullness.
